Seminar 6: Business Protocol: Polishing Your Image

Business protocol savvy and impeccable manners are fundamental to developing a leadership presence. The ability to greet and introduce with poise, host with finesse, and engage in comfortable casual conversation, speaks volumes about you. Go beyond the basics to an understanding of key strategies to help you interact comfortably and with confidence in a variety of business and social events. Learn about culture differences and guidelines for developing greater impact and ease through this entertaining, eye-opening program.

Participants will learn to:

  • Manage interpersonal relationships
  • Establish a commanding presence in any social/business setting
  • Host a perfect meeting, dinner, or special event
  • Become a master at networking
  • Entertain with ease at conventions and sports or cultural events

Suggested Timeframe: Half- or full-day program.

Program Option: To recreate personal challenges in the real world and to enhance etiquette awareness, a portion of the program can be conducted in a restaurant. Participants will engage in activities that will teach them how to host a meal, learn the art of introductions, and hone heir table manners in an authentic setting.
